Q: Is 7,107,776 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 7,107,776 is a composite number.

Why is 7,107,776 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 7,107,776 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 13 16 26 32 52 64 104 208 416 832 8,543 17,086 34,172 68,344 111,059 136,688 222,118 273,376 444,236 546,752 888,472 1,776,944 3,553,888 and 7,107,776, with no remainder.

Since 7,107,776 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,107,776, it is a composite number.
